《QTP自动化测试权威指南(第二版)》—第1章1.3节什么是HP QuickTest Professional(QTP)

简介:

本节书摘来自异步社区《QTP自动化测试权威指南(第二版)》一书中的第1章1.3节什么是HP QuickTest Professional(QTP),作者【印度】Tarun Lalwani,更多章节内容可以访问云栖社区“异步社区”公众号查看。

1.3 什么是HP QuickTest Professional(QTP)
QTP自动化测试权威指南(第二版)
HP公司的QTP是针对功能测试的自动化工具。它本身支持录制回放功能,藉此自动化工程师可以录制捕获对被测试应用的操作事件,并且在测试阶段回放。

QTP提供两种模式查看和编辑测试脚本。

关键字视图。
专家视图。
关键字视图以关键字的方式显示脚本(每个对象是一个图标),以树状格式排列,方便很少或没有编程背景的业务专家。关键字视图如下面截图,如图1-2所示。


7b8c2206fdf9f1c3c4b9b182db4f3c31c2548ff5

专家视图将隐藏在关键字视图中图标底下的VBScript脚本展示出来,并提供了关键字视图下不具备的实质性的功能,如图1-3所示。

2dff17a7df87156971ace8125bab4b82285ba374

本书是面向准备使用专家视图模式发掘QTP强大功能的自动化工程师。

57cf3bc5e38e614de2dc45d230b5e5d499258957

QTP使用VBScript作为编程语言。差不多所有VBScript的功能都可以在专家视图中使用,但也存在部分限制。了解一个测试架构中相关的QTP VBScript是相当重要的。本书也在这方面做了阐述。
本文仅用于学习和交流目的,不代表异步社区观点。非商业转载请注明作译者、出处,并保留本文的原始链接。
相关文章
|
测试技术
软件测试面试题:QTP中的Action有什么作用?有几种?
软件测试面试题:QTP中的Action有什么作用?有几种?
102 0
|
测试技术
软件测试面试题:使用QTP做功能测试,录制脚本的时候,要验证多个用户的登录情况\/查询情况,如何操作?
软件测试面试题:使用QTP做功能测试,录制脚本的时候,要验证多个用户的登录情况\/查询情况,如何操作?
66 0
|
测试技术 数据格式 XML
QTP测试的数据驱动
从文本文件读取数据作为测试的数据 Dim oShell Set oShell=CreateObject("WSCript.shell") oShell.Run "calc",1 Wait 2 'Window("计算器").
821 0
|
测试技术 Windows
QTP测试Windows计算器
QTP是自动化测试的工具,可以使用编写脚本或录制的方式进行测试自动化: 下面是对Windows自带计算器的测试 首先写入脚本,使用VBScript打开计算器 Dim oShellSet oShell=CreateObject("WSCript.
1805 0